How do solar cells convert light into electricity?

Solar cells, also known as photovoltaic cells, convert light energy directly into electrical energy. They are made primarily from semiconductor materials, with silicon being the most common. When sunlight strikes the surface of a solar cell, it excites electrons in the semiconductor material, creating an electric current.

From sunlight to electricity

Photovoltaic solar panels absorb this energy from the Sun and convert it into electricity; A solar cell is made from two layers of silicon—one ''doped'' with a tiny amount of added phosphorus (n-type: ''n'' for negative), the other with a tiny amount of boron (p-type: ''p'' for positive)

Solar Panels: Direct Sunlight vs Shade — Sustainable Review

Cloud cover reduces the intensity of sunlight reaching the solar panels, resulting in lower electricity generation. Solar panels can still produce electricity on cloudy days, although at a reduced rate compared to sunny days. On average, solar panels can generate around 10-25% of their maximum capacity under cloudy conditions.

How is Solar Energy Converted to Electricity?

When we install solar panels, we are harnessing light energy from the sun. When the light strikes the surface of the semiconductor material, a reaction takes place, which converts the light energy into electrical energy. But since solar panels aren''t 100% efficient, some of this light energy becomes heat.
